Nationally ranked Ohio Northern raced past the Muskies Saturday afternoon in Ohio Athletic Conference action at the ONU Sports Center, 96-73.
The Basics
- Records: Muskingum (8-7 overall, 4-4 OAC), Ohio Northern (15-0 overall, 8-0 OAC)
- Location: Ada, Ohio - ONU Sports Center
Inside the Numbers
- Three players finished in double figures for the Muskies.
- Senior Mallory Taylor led the way with a team-high 18 points and five rebounds.
- Junior Olivia Besancon netted 14 points, while junior Caitlyn Smith recorded 13 points and dished out four assists.
- Muskingum ended the outing shooting .387 (24-for-62) from the floor.
- ONU was led by Amy Bullimore with a game-high 21 points and eight rebounds.
- Jenna Dirksen chipped in 20 points for the Polar Bears.
- Northern shot .514 from the field.
Game Notes
- The Muskies used a 7-0 run with 7:02 to play in the second period to capture its largest lead of the contest 35-31.
- Northern closed out the period on a 14-7 run to claim the 45-42 halftime advantage.
- The Polar Bears outscored Muskingum 25-16 in the third period to take the 70-58 lead into the final frame.
